Two soft-decision algorithms for decoding the (6,3,4) quaternary code, the hexacode, are presented. Both algorithms have the same guaranteed error correction radius as that of maximum-likelihood decoding. In using them, bounded-distance decoding of the Golay code and the Leech lattice are performed in at most 187 and 519 real operations respectively. We present some simulation results for the Leech lattice decoder revealing near-optimal performance. A comparison to known trellis codes is also provided.
